In a indemnification clause, one party undertakes to protect the other from certain damages. Such damages may include property damage or bodily injury caused by the actions of certain persons or organizations. In your case, this would include the guards, your company or your client. The problem with compensation is that they can put you on the spot for damages that really weren`t your responsibility. Avoid them as much as possible. Often seen in indemnification agreements, additional insurance status refers to a clause that protects your client in case the indemnification clause is unenforceable. These also come in limited, medium and wide applications, such as remuneration. If your additional insured care is broader than your own insurance policy, you are also dealing with self-insurance. Typically, a contract with a security company has a 30-day cancellation clause. Make sure your contract includes a clause that applies to both the agency and you so that the agency doesn`t leave and leave you unprotected. In most cases, a contract with a security company includes a statement that your agency is an independent contractor and not an agent for the client. Theoretically, this wording protects the client from any liability for the acts and omissions of your agency. In addition, it protects you and the client from shared work claims, which can lead to both of you being held liable for employee-related claims such as benefits, pensions, and union affairs.

A defense and indemnification clause or „harmless“ language provides protection against lawsuits arising from the negligence of the security protection authority. It guarantees that the security company is responsible for the legal defense costs incurred to defend a claim resulting from the negligence of a security guard and the compensation granted to the injured party. 12.
